SP-2230N and SP-2240N side by side

Same design and the same software. The difference is scanning speed and daily volume.

SP-2230NSP-2240N
Scanning speed (A4 colour)30 ppm / 60 ipm duplex40 ppm / 80 ipm duplex
Rated daily volume4,500 sheets6,000 sheets
Feeder capacity80 sheets (80gsm A4)
Paper handling27 to 413gsm, plastic cards to 1.4mm, folded A3, long pages to 6m
Optical resolution600 dpi (1200 dpi maximum output)
ConnectionsUSB 3.2 Gen 1x1 and Gigabit Ethernet
Scanning without a PCDirectScan to three destinations, built-in OCR
Software suppliedPaperStream IP, Capture, ClickScan, Central Admin
Size and weight292 x 163 x 150 mm, 3.3 kg
WarrantyOne year, manufacturer

Are Ricoh scanners the same as Fujitsu scanners?

They are. Ricoh bought PFU Limited, the company that made the Fujitsu-branded document scanner range, and the scanners are now sold under the Ricoh name. The ScanSnap, fi Series and SP Series models are the same hardware and software you may know as Fujitsu scanners.

What is the difference between the Ricoh SP-2230N and SP-2240N?

They share the same body, an 80-sheet feeder, LAN and USB 3.2, and the same PaperStream software. The SP-2230N scans at 30 pages per minute and is rated for 4,500 sheets a day. The SP-2240N scans at 40 pages per minute and is rated for 6,000 sheets a day. Pick the SP-2240N if your team scans more.

Do the Ricoh SP scanners need a PC to scan?

No. Using DirectScan, you press a button on the scanner to send documents to one of three preset destinations. The scanner has built-in OCR, so it can create searchable PDFs without a computer attached.

What software comes with Ricoh scanners?

SP and fi Series scanners come with the PaperStream software: PaperStream IP (the driver, with image clean-up and OCR), PaperStream Capture (for automating scan jobs) and PaperStream ClickScan (one-button scanning to the cloud). They also support TWAIN and ISIS, so they work with other capture software.

Can Ricoh scanners handle receipts, plastic cards and folded A3?

Yes. The SP-2230N and SP-2240N take paper from 27gsm to 413gsm, embossed plastic cards up to 1.4mm thick, and folded A3 sheets. The 80-sheet feeder and paper-protection sensor mean you can scan mixed batches without sorting them first.
